#e74657 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e74657 is composed of 90.6% red, 27.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 353.7 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 59%. #e74657 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cae with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#e74657 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e74657 has RGB values of R:231, G:70,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.62,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15156823.

Shades and Tints of #e74657
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fef4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e74657
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979696 is the less saturated color, while #f7364a is the most saturated one.
